1. (masculine or mixed gender) (third person plural)
A word or phrase used to refer to a group including masculine words or both masculine and feminine words (e.g., bienvenidos).
a. to see them again
Hace mucho que no veo a mis hermanos y estoy deseando verlos de nuevo.I haven't seen my brothers for a long time and I'm looking forward to seeing them again.
2. (masculine or mixed gender) (second person plural)
A word or phrase used to refer to a group including masculine words or both masculine and feminine words (e.g., bienvenidos).
a. to see you again
Yo también voy a la fiesta, así que los veré de nuevo muy pronto. - ¡Estupendo! ¡Hasta entonces!I'm going to the party too, so I'll see you again very soon. - Great! See you then!
